Project Manager - Change & Transformation
About the role
Project Manager with excellent experience leading business change, transformation, and organisational design initiatives required on a permanent basis by a leading wealth management firm based in their Swindon HQ (3 days / week on site).

The client is in a phase of accelerated growth across their enterprise change function, with substantial investment in technology, transformation, and operating model evolution.
You will own project delivery, leading the end-to-end delivery of multiple projects focused on business change, transformation, organisational design, and process improvement. This will include shaping and implementing target operating models, supporting structural change, and ensuring alignment between strategy, processes, and people. You will take ownership of timelines, budgets, resources, risks, and issues, acting as the key point of contact for stakeholders.
To be considered for this opportunity, applicants must have the following:
- Excellent experience as a Project Manager
- Financial Services exposure
- Strong experience leading end-to-end business change, transformation, and organisational design projects
- Experience delivering operating model design and implementation
- Demonstrable process improvement skills (i.e. Lean Six Sigma)
- Hands-on experience supporting Agile delivery (Scrum & Kanban)
- Certification in project management (i.e. PMP, Prince2, Agile, SAFe)
- Ability to cut through ambiguity and operate in a dynamic environment
- Excellent prioritisation skills across change, budgeting & resource allocation
- Exemplary stakeholder management & communication skills
This is an excellent opportunity for a hands-on, delivery-focused Project Manager keen to take real ownership, with the ability to inspire and motivate matrix teams, communicate effectively at all levels, and drive successful outcomes in a fast-paced environment.
You will lead end-to-end project delivery, owning governance, timelines, risks, and quality. Acting as the key stakeholder contact, you will provide clear updates and build strong relationships, motivate teams, resolve challenges, and ensure successful outcomes whilst championing continuous improvement. This is a permanent position based in Swindon (3 days / week), offering a salary between £55,000 – £60,000 + bonus + excellent benefits package.
